We are seeking a Licensed Counselor or Social Worker!
Fairfield Community Health Center, Fairfield County, OH

LSW, LPC, LISW, LPCC

Join our team!

Fairfield Community Health Center works to improve the overall health and wellness of our community. Our purpose is to make sure everyone has access to quality, affordable healthcare, regardless of insurance or income status.

Our integrated approach uses evidence-based care, which gives us a complete look at all aspects of your health to determine the best health plan to fit your unique needs.

As a Federally Qualified Health Center (FQHC), we are held to the highest quality standards in the healthcare industry.

We are seeking a full-time licensed counselor or social worker to serve youth and adults in need of Behavioral Health services.

The salary range for this position is $47,609.67 to $71,675.95 per year based on experience.

  • Dependently Licensed: $22.29/hr. - $26.82/hr.
  • Dependently Licensed, Seeking Independent Licensure: $24.93/hr. - $29.20/hr.
  • Independently Licensed: $61,174.73-$71,675.95 annually

Essential Functions:

  • Assesses or defines the strengths and needs of referred individuals and families.
  • Directly provides and coordinates clinical and social services that are problem-focused and build on family and community strengths.
  • Carries out utilization review and quality assurance activities as directed.
  • Maintains necessary documentation, participates in program evaluation, attends team and program planning meetings, cross-systems training, and acquires knowledge of community resources.
  • Meets billing productivity requirements established by Integrated Services for Behavioral Health.
  • Other duties as assigned.

Minimum Requirements:

  • Must meet requirements for licensure as defined by the Ohio Counselor, Social Worker, and Marriage & Family Therapist Board.
  • Experience with multi-need individuals and families.
  • Broad knowledge of community service systems.
  • Willing to participate in and lead cross-systems team-building activities.
  • Able to effectively communicate through verbal/written expression.
  • Must be able to operate in an Internet-based, automated office environment.
